统一账户管理系统项目如何高效落地?关键步骤与实施策略全解析
在数字化转型浪潮中,企业对客户、员工、合作伙伴等多角色的账户管理需求日益复杂。传统分散式账户体系导致数据孤岛严重、运营效率低下、合规风险增加。因此,构建一个统一账户管理系统(Unified Account Management System, UAMS)成为众多组织的战略重点。那么,统一账户管理系统项目究竟该如何高效推进?本文将从项目规划、架构设计、技术选型、数据治理、安全合规到落地执行全流程进行深度剖析,帮助企业在有限资源下实现高价值交付。
一、明确目标:为什么要做统一账户管理系统?
首先,必须回答“我们为什么要建这个系统?”这是整个项目的起点。
- 业务驱动:提升用户体验(如单点登录SSO)、降低客户流失率、支持多渠道营销整合。
- 运营优化:减少重复开户流程、统一身份认证标准、提高客服响应速度。
- 合规要求:满足GDPR、《个人信息保护法》等法规对数据集中存储和访问控制的要求。
- 战略协同:为后续CRM、ERP、BI等系统的集成打下基础,推动企业级数字底座建设。
建议采用SMART原则制定项目目标,例如:“6个月内完成核心用户群体的账户统一管理覆盖,实现95%以上操作自动化,同时通过ISO 27001认证。”
二、顶层设计:搭建合理的系统架构
统一账户管理系统不是简单的数据库迁移,而是涉及身份识别、权限分配、审计追踪等多个维度的复杂工程。
1. 架构模式选择
常见架构包括:
- 中心化架构:适用于单一组织内部,所有账户由中央平台统一管理,适合中小型企业或初期试点。
- 分布式微服务架构:适合大型集团企业,支持跨部门、跨地域的数据隔离与权限细化,利于未来扩展。
- 混合云架构:兼顾私有化部署的安全性与公有云的弹性扩展能力,尤其适用于金融、医疗等行业。
2. 核心功能模块设计
建议包含以下模块:
- 身份管理中心(IdM):支持LDAP/AD集成、OAuth2.0/OpenID Connect协议,实现跨应用的身份同步。
- 权限控制系统(RBAC/ABAC):基于角色或属性动态授权,确保最小权限原则。
- 审计日志模块:记录所有账户操作行为,用于事后追溯与合规审查。
- 自助服务平台:允许用户修改密码、重置权限、查看历史记录,减轻IT负担。
- API网关与集成接口:提供标准化RESTful API供其他系统调用,避免重复开发。
三、技术选型与工具链推荐
技术选型直接决定项目的可维护性和扩展性。以下是一些主流方案:
1. 数据库层
- 关系型数据库:MySQL、PostgreSQL(适合结构化账户信息)。
- NoSQL数据库:MongoDB、Redis(用于缓存高频访问的用户状态或临时令牌)。
2. 身份认证框架
- Keycloak:开源、易集成、支持多租户,适合中小企业快速启动。
- Okta / Azure AD:商业产品,功能完整但成本较高,适合大型企业长期投入。
3. 开发语言与框架
- Java + Spring Boot:稳定性强,生态成熟,适合企业级开发。
- Node.js + Express:轻量灵活,适合微服务拆分后的快速迭代。
4. DevOps与CI/CD工具
- GitLab CI / Jenkins + Docker + Kubernetes:实现自动化部署与版本回滚能力。
四、数据治理:打通数据孤岛的关键
很多统一账户项目失败的根本原因在于数据质量差或未建立统一标准。
1. 数据清洗与映射
需要梳理现有各系统的账户字段差异,比如:
- 原系统A中的“用户名” vs 系统B中的“工号” vs 系统C中的“邮箱”
- 手机号格式不一致(+86开头 vs 0086开头)
建议使用ETL工具(如Apache NiFi、Talend)进行批量转换,并设立数据字典规范。
2. 主数据管理(MDM)
引入主数据管理系统,定义“唯一真实来源”,防止多个系统各自为政。
3. 实时同步机制
采用消息队列(如Kafka、RabbitMQ)实现账户变更事件的实时广播,确保所有下游系统及时更新。
五、安全与合规:不容忽视的红线
统一账户系统一旦被攻破,可能引发连锁反应。必须提前规划安全防线。
1. 认证安全
- 启用多因素认证(MFA),尤其是管理员账号。
- 定期轮换密钥,禁止硬编码敏感信息。
2. 权限最小化原则
严格按照岗位职责分配权限,避免“超级管理员”滥用权力。
3. 审计与监控
- 启用SIEM(安全信息与事件管理)工具(如Splunk、ELK Stack)进行日志分析。
- 设置异常登录告警规则(如异地登录、非工作时间访问)。
4. 合规认证准备
提前对照GDPR、网络安全法、等级保护2.0等标准,制定差距分析报告并整改。
六、分阶段实施:从小处着手,逐步推广
不要试图一次性覆盖所有用户和业务场景,应采取敏捷方式分步推进:
阶段一:试点验证(1-3个月)
- 选取1个部门或1类用户(如HR员工)作为试点。
- 上线基础功能(注册、登录、密码重置)。
- 收集反馈,优化UI/UX和流程逻辑。
阶段二:局部推广(3-6个月)
- 扩展至2-3个核心业务线(如销售、客服)。
- 接入权限控制、审计模块。
- 开展培训,培养内部运维团队。
阶段三:全面落地(6-12个月)
- 覆盖全部内外部用户群体。
- 对接已有系统(CRM、OA、财务系统)。
- 建立持续改进机制,定期评估性能与安全性。
七、常见陷阱与规避建议
- 陷阱1:忽视业务部门参与 —— 解决方案:成立跨职能项目组,包括IT、HR、法务、风控等部门代表。
- 陷阱2:过度追求完美设计 —— 解决方案:优先交付MVP(最小可行产品),快速迭代优化。
- 陷阱3:缺乏持续运维能力 —— 解决方案:在项目初期就培养本地工程师团队,避免后期依赖外部厂商。
- 陷阱4:忽略用户习惯改变 —— 解决方案:加强培训与宣传,设计友好的引导界面,降低学习成本。
八、成功案例参考
某省级银行在2023年成功实施UAMS项目后,实现了以下成果:
- 账户创建时间从平均4小时缩短至15分钟;
- 客户投诉率下降37%;
- 年度合规检查一次性通过,节省罚款约200万元;
- 为后续智能风控、精准营销奠定基础。
结语:统一账户不是终点,而是起点
统一账户管理系统项目不仅是技术升级,更是组织变革的过程。它帮助企业打破壁垒、提升效率、增强信任。只要科学规划、稳步推进、注重细节,就能让这一系统真正成为企业的数字基石。未来的竞争,不再是单点优势的竞争,而是整体协同能力的竞争——而统一账户系统,正是这场战役的关键武器。

